Licensing Program Analysts (LPAs) Elizabeth Irra and Mayra Cota conducted the required annual inspection. LPA met with Dennely Zarazua/S-1 and discussed the purpose of today’s visit.

This home consists of (3) bedrooms, (1) bathroom, kitchen, dining area, living room and an attached garage. All clients residing at this home receive case management services provided by San Gabriel Pomona Regional Center. This home is approved for (6) ambulatory clients.

LPA utilized the Compliance and Regulatory (CARE) tools for the visit today and observed the following:
Infection Control: Facility has an Infection Control plan in place.

Operational Requirements: Staff are adhering to operational requirements.

Physical Plant & Environment Safety: Smoke alarms and carbon monoxide detector tested and operable. Fire extinguishers appear to be full (laundry/kitchen and living room). Knives, cleaning solutions, and disinfectants are locked and inaccessible to clients.

Staffing: There is sufficient staffing at the facility. Staff employed are over the age of 18 and are fingerprint cleared and associated to the facility.

Personnel Records-Training: LPA reviewed staff files for Staff #1 (S-1) and Staff #5 (S-5). Staff have current First Aid/CPR certification. Staff have their Health Screening and Tuberculosis.

Client Rights-Information: Client rights are posted and were also observed in client files.

Client Records-Incident Reports: LPA reviewed Client files for Client #1 (C-1) through Client #6 (C-6). Client files are maintained at the facility. Admission Agreement, Physician's Report (including T.B and Ambulatory Status), Weight Record, Functional Capabilities Assessment, Consent For Medical Treatment, House Rules, Individual Program Plan, and Client Rights were observed.

Food Service: There are sufficient food supplies of 2-day perishable and (1) week of non-perishable items. The food is properly stored in the refrigerator. Cleaning supplies are kept away from the food preparation areas. The kitchen is kept clean and free from rodents and other vermin. Plates, cups and utensils are kept cleaned and stored properly.

Health Related Services: The medications are centrally stored and locked inside a cabinet. Medications are administered as prescribed by the Physician.

Incidental Medical Services: Per S-1, there are (0) clients with a restrictive health plan, (0) client utilizing postural supports and (0) clients with prohibited health conditions.

Disaster Preparedness: The facility has an Emergency Disaster Plan in place.

Exit interview, appeals rights and a copy of this report was provided to Lauren Goodman.
